
CONNECT TECH, INC.

DFLEX-2

Card Type          Serial card
Chipset Controller UART 16450 or 16550
I/O Options        Serial port (2)
Maximum DRAM       N/A

[Image]

                                CONNECTIONS

      Purpose            Location           Purpose           Location

  9-pin serial port        CN1         *SLIM connector           S1
  connector                            (Port 1 & 2)

  9-pin serial port        CN2
  connector

  *Note: Serial Line Interface Module (SLIM) connectors.

                               SERIAL PORT 1

               Setting                               SW1/1

             COM1 (3F8h)                               On

             User select                              Off

  Note: When SW1/1 is set in the off position refer to Serial & Status
  Port Address table.

                               SERIAL PORT 2

               Setting                               SW1/2

             COM2 (2F8h)                               On

             User select                              Off

  Note: When SW1/2 is set in the off position refer to Serial & Status
  Port Address table.

                       SERIAL & STATUS PORT ADDRESS

   Port 1     Port 2       Status       SW1/3        SW1/4       SW1/5
                            port

    200h       208h         240h          On          On           On

    240h       248h         280h          On          On          Off

    280h       288h         2C0h          On          Off          On

    2C0h       2C8h         300h          On          Off         Off

    300h       308h         340h         Off          On           On

    2B0h       2B8h         288h         Off          On          Off

    290h       298h         2D0h         Off          Off          On

    190h       198h         1D0h         Off          Off         Off

      STATUS PORT

  Setting      SW1/7

  Enabled       On

  Disabled      Off

                            INTERRUPT CHANNEL A

    IRQ          J1/A            J1/B           J1/C            J1/D

     3         Pins 1 & 2        Open           Open            Open
                closed

     4           Open         Pins 1 & 2        Open            Open
                                closed

     5           Open            Open         Pins 1 & 2        Open
                                               closed

     7           Open            Open           Open          Pins 1 & 2
                                                               closed

     10          Open            Open           Open            Open

     11          Open            Open           Open            Open

     12          Open            Open           Open            Open

     15          Open            Open           Open            Open

                        INTERRUPT CHANNEL A (CONT)

  iRQ        J1/E         J1/F          J1/G          J1/H        SW1/8

   3         Open         Open          Open          Open         On

   4         Open         Open          Open          Open         On

   5         Open         Open          Open          Open         On

   7         Open         Open          Open          Open         On

   10     Pins 1 & 2      Open          Open          Open         On
            closed

   11        Open       Pins 1 & 2      Open          Open         On
                         closed

   12        Open         Open       Pins 1 & 2       Open         On
                                       closed

   15        Open         Open          Open       Pins 1 & 2      On
                                                     closed

       Note: When port 1 is configured as COM1 & port 2 is configured as
       COM2, SW1/8 should be in the off position. IRQ4 (COM1) should have
       channel A settings & IRQ3 (COM2) should have channel B settings.
       If only one of the first two ports is configured as COM1 or COM2,
       the other jumper can be moved or removed according to the
       requirements of the software being used.
